The issue is that teammates might verbally abuse another until they finally disconnect, resulting in loss prevented for the rest of the team.

Also, systems that automatically report or detect anything are not foolproof. If someone has a bad game and dies a lot, they'll be 'detected' as intentionally feeding.

The end point is that I'd rather put up with trolls and feeders and afks, than to have someone completely innocent be punished for something they didn't do.

To piggyback onto what Krigjer has been saying, it's really easy to abuse a system like this. I agree with him/her as far as preferences are concerned, I'd much rather deal with the occasional ragequit than introduce a system people can abuse to inflate their LP or use as an excuse to abuse each other.

One thing that does frustrate me, however, is when games still continue if someone never connects at all. That scenario really shouldn't be that hard to regulate, especially since it's basically non-abusable (why afk at the start and lose 20 LP if you can dodge to lose 3?).
